    Terminal Supervisor

     

    Job ID #: 31301 Location: FL-TAMPA

     

    Functional Area: Management Position Type: Full Time

     

    Experience Required: 1 - 3 Years Relocation Provided: No

     

    Education Required: High School Diploma

     

    RC/Department: 6422 -L.RIVER PORT SUTTON TERMINAL :BTLC5

    Position Description

    PRIMARY RESPONSIBILITIES: The Terminal Supervisor is responsible for the oversight and management of maintenance and vessel operations under the direction of the Terminal manager. He/she ensures safe, efficient, and economical operation and general maintenance of the terminal(s). SUPERVISORY RESPONSIBILITIES:

     

    + Coordinates and supervises the performance of Terminal Operatons and maintenance at designated locations and reports to the Terminal manager

    JOB RESPONSIBILITIES:

    + Supervise frontline Terminal teammates

    + Develop and maintain work plans and schedule for teammates

    + Monitor overtime

    + Training of new hires

    + Maintain terminal supplies

    + Monthly conveyor and equipment inspections and regulatory requirements

    + Perform terminal maintenance operations on an as-needed basis

    + Other duties as assigned

    Position Requirements

    EDUCATION High School Diploma or equivalent EXPERIENCE, SPECIFIC KNOWLEDGE, LICENSES, CERTIFICATIONS Sufficient terminals related experience to effectively work as the Terminal Supervisor. Must demonstrate initiative and self-motivation. Must have organizational skills to handle a variety of matters simultaneously. Must be able to accept direction and supervision and work effectively and cooperatively with people. Must have and maintain a valid drivers license and be insurable under the policy. COMPETENCIES/SKILLS Must have good reading and basic computer skills (Word, Excel, email). Must be able to effectively communicate, orally and in writing, with coworkers, contractors, government officials and Senior Management. WORKING CONDITIONS Must be able to be on call and report as needed and be able to work extended hours as required in emergencies, equipment or service interruptions, and/or other related circumstances.
